Game Day Specials
When the Premier League rolls around, Horn & Trumpet ups its game with a menu of hearty pub fare. Think classic pies, chips, and burgers, all priced between £10 and £20. It’s like the kitchen knows that nothing pairs better with football than a pint and a plate of something substantial. Sunday roasts are popular, drawing in regulars looking for a proper feed before or after the match.
Screen Setup & Sound
You can’t go wrong with the screen setup here. Several large screens ensure that no one misses a moment, whether you’re perched at the bar or squished in a cosy corner. The sound system doesn’t hold back either; you’ll hear every shout from the pundits, making you feel part of the action (even if you’re just nursing a pint). It’s a place where the atmosphere matches the intensity of the game.
